Output c42521ef31fa74bd8119609bf4152e505d391b61f67ab5dfda00c7f312673d58: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3318b35b16909140ada5c60a830a3cd498b2f998 OP_EQUAL
address
36MByZAtjcQqk2e1gLXTEWFzoYPbU79Skb
transaction
c42521ef31fa74bd8119609bf4152e505d391b61f67ab5dfda00c7f312673d58
spent
true